   I am working on Outlook 2007 PlugIns. I want to know how I can access the fields like firstname, lastname, ... from the Contact Form. Suppose I clicked on New option for creating new contact and I entered some values into the Contact fields (firstname - Joe, lastname - Smith,...) and then I need to get the entered values from the Contact fields for saving that contact record into local database.

So - How would I solve this:

I would use an Inspector-Wrapper and hook into the Item Write event.
This is fired before the Item is saved into Outlook.
Here you can grab all Properties and save it to your DB.
